How to Make Crispy Baked Broccoli Cheese Balls
Quick Overview
Crafting these bites is not only easy but also incredibly satisfying. In just about 30 minutes, you’ll create crispy balls that are perfectly baked with a satisfying crunch on the outside and creamy goodness on the inside. It’s the perfect recipe to whip up quickly for family dinners or to impress guests unexpectedly.
Preparation Time
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 30 minutes
Key Ingredients for Crispy Baked Broccoli Cheese Balls
To create these delightful Crispy Baked Broccoli Cheese Balls, you will need the following ingredients:
- 2 cups broccoli florets, finely chopped
- 1 cup shredded cheese (preferably cheddar or a Halal-friendly cheese)
- 1/2 cup breadcrumbs (preferably whole wheat for a healthier twist)
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up finely chopped onion
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 1 large egg, beaten (or a seed-based egg replacement for a vegan option)
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
- 1 tsp Italian seasoning or dried herbs (optional)
- Cooking spray or olive oil for baking
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Preheat the Oven: Begin by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). This ensures that your broccoli balls will have a crisp texture when baked.
- Cook the Broccoli: Steam the broccoli florets until they are tender but still vibrant green, about 3-4 minutes. Drain and let them cool slightly before finely chopping.
- Mix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the chopped broccoli, shredded cheese,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, chopped onion, minced garlic, beaten egg, salt, black pepper, and Italian seasoning. Stir until all ingredients are well incorporated.
- Form the Balls: Using your hands, take small portions of the mixture and roll them into 1-inch balls. Place them on a greased baking sheet, leaving some space between each ball.
- Bake: Lightly spray the broccoli balls with cooking spray or drizzle them with olive oil for extra crispness. B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es, or until golden brown and crisp.
- Serve: Remove from the oven and let cool for a couple of minutes before serving with your favorite dipping sauce!
Top Tips for Perfecting Crispy Baked Broccoli Cheese Balls
- Substitutions: Feel free to experiment! Swap the cheese for a vegan alternative if desired, or mix in other finely chopped vegetables like carrots or bell peppers for added nutrition.
- Avoid Common Mistakes: Make sure to finely chop the broccoli and other ingredients to ensure they bind well together. Also, ensure you don’t overbake; the goal is crispy on the outside and gooey on the inside!
- Timing is Key: If you’re cooking for a larger crowd, you can double the recipe and freeze extras for quick meals later. Just remember to adjust the baking time accordingly.
Storing and Reheating Tips
To store your delicious Crispy Baked Broccoli Cheese Balls, place them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They will last for up to 4 days. For longer-term storage, these bites freeze well and can be kept for up to 3 months.
When it’s time to reheat, place them in an oven preheated to 375°F (190°C) for about 10-15 minutes, ensuring they regain their crispy texture. Avoid the microwave as it can make them soggy!
